Kettle 3.0用户指南:ETL工具详解与操作教程

需积分: 17 1 下载量 61 浏览量 更新于2024-07-29 收藏 10.3MB PDF 举报
《Kettle 3.0用户手册》是深圳市神盾信息技术有限公司发布的一份详细的文档,旨在指导用户理解和操作ETL (Extract, Transform, Load) 工具Kettle。该手册共分为9个主要部分,涵盖了Kettle的基础概念、安装与运行、核心组件的使用以及高级功能。 1. **Kettle简介**: - Kettle是一款开源的工具,用于数据集成,支持数据抽取、转换和加载,帮助用户从不同数据源提取数据,进行清洗、转换,然后将结果加载到目标数据库或文件系统。 - 安装步骤包括下载、解压并按照指示配置环境,用户还需要学会如何启动Spoon,Kettle图形化的用户界面。 2. **资源库管理**: - Kettle支持资源库,方便存储和组织转换和任务,可以自动登录,提高了效率。 - 转换和任务是Kettle的核心概念,分别指数据处理流程和周期性执行的任务。 3. **创建转换和任务**: - 用户手册详细解释了如何从头开始创建新的转换或任务,包括设置基本参数和配置。 4. **数据库连接**: - 提供了数据库连接的设置方法,包括描述、窗口配置、选项以及数据库操作的指导。 5. **SQL编辑器和数据库浏览器**: - SQL编辑器允许用户编写和测试SQL语句,而数据库浏览器则用于浏览和探索数据库结构。 6. **节点连接**: - 节点连接涉及到转换之间的数据流动,包括转换连接、任务连接的创建、拆分和颜色标记,有助于可视化数据流。 7. **变量的使用**: - 变量在Kettle中扮演重要角色,包括环境变量、Kettle变量和内部变量,它们提供了灵活性,以便动态调整数据处理过程。 8. **转换设置**: - 这部分讲解了如何配置转换的全局设置,如屏幕截图展示的选项,以及其他高级特性。 9. **转换步骤**: - 用户指南深入介绍了如何创建、复制和管理转换中的步骤,以及错误处理和分布机制。 这份手册不仅适合初次接触Kettle的新手,也对有经验的用户提供了深入的参考,确保他们在使用过程中能够熟练掌握和优化数据处理流程。通过学习和实践,用户可以充分利用Kettle的强大功能来管理和迁移数据。